Latest reports on Rebecca Arthur say that the 17-year old girl, after being reported as missing on Wednesday night, was finally found safe by authorities.

Arthur was located on Friday at around 3 a.m. by Moroccan police in cooperation with the investigation by the FBI and Homeland Security. She was seen in the company of Simo El Adala, who authorities suspect was the man she met on Facebook and eventually became her boyfriend.

Arthur took an international flight on Monday, July 6 at JFK Airport after she was dropped off by her parents. The girl allegedly told her parents that she was going to visit a friend in California.

She arrived in Morocco on Tuesday, July 7. Her parents never heard anything from her since she left, which prompted them to contact the police and report her as missing.

According to the police, Arthur flew to Morocco in order to meet her boyfriend. Her parents were completely unaware of her plans to travel all by herself to the North African country. They also didn't know about her alleged relationship with the man on Facebook.

"The daughter had no intent of going to California," said Sgt. Jeremiah Dunn, spokesman for Clinton Police. "We don't know what her motive was, why she flew to Morocco."

Detectives suspected that Arthur had planned to meet up with her friend from Facebook, who carries the name Simo El Adala.

"We don't even know if this is a real person," said Dunn.

Both Arthur's and El Adala's Facebook pages claim that they have been in a relationship since February of this year. Each has placed the other's picture as a cover photo on their Facebook pages. In one of Arthur's posted images, someone placed a comment asking who the man was. She replied, "he's my bf tehehe loll."

Authorities believe that El Adala must have paid for Arthur's plane ticket, which cost nothing less than $1,000. Arthur was said to have $25 in her pocket when she traveled on Monday.

On that day, she was reported as wearing black yoga pants and a black sleeveless shirt with Nike sneakers in hues of pink, white and blue. She was also seen with a red suitcase.

Authorities were concerned that Arthur went to a country that has been listed as a dangerous destination for Americans. Based on the State Department's website, Morocco has the potential of committing terrorist violence against citizens of the U.S. and its interests.
